Several oral peptide drugs have already been approved for the management of chronic diseases, including RYBELSUS (Semaglutide) for type 2 diabetes, DAYBUE (Trofinetide) for Rett syndrome, LUPKYNIS (Voclosporin) for lupus nephritis, and TRULANCE (Plecanatide) for chronic idiopathic constipation and irritable bowel syndrome with constipation
